What are the cultivation methods and precautions of Brazilian wild peony?

Brazilian wild peony cultivation method

Brazilian wild peony is an evergreen shrub of the wild peony family. It is usually planted by cutting propagation. It prefers high temperature environment and is relatively cold-resistant.

1. Soil

When planting Brazilian wild peony, generally use slightly alkaline soil that is well-drained, loose and fertile, which is more conducive to its growth and development.

2. Lighting

Brazilian wild peony needs plenty of sunlight when it is being cared for, which will allow it to grow faster and bloom more.

3. Temperature

Brazilian wild peony has good adaptability and can grow in high temperature environments as well as in relatively low temperature environments.

4. Watering

Brazilian wild peony is afraid of waterlogging, so it needs to be watered in moderation and water accumulation should not occur, otherwise it will cause root rot.

5. Fertilization

Brazilian wild peony is relatively fertile, so it needs sufficient fertilizer when cultivating. However, it should be applied thinly and frequently. You can apply compound fertilizer once a month to promote its growth, which can effectively increase the amount of flowering.

6. Pruning

Brazilian wild peony needs to be pruned when it sprouts in spring. Generally, about 5 branches need to be left. This can concentrate nutrients and allow it to grow better.

Precautions for cultivation of Brazilian wild peony

You need to be careful when caring for the Brazilian wild peony. Although it is relatively cold-resistant, in order to make it grow better, it is best to move it indoors for maintenance in winter so that it can grow better in the coming year.
